Description

Fully Furnished Gorgeous 2 Bed, 2.5 Bath on Quinnipiac River. This home has a private dock, a hot tub, water views, multiple outdoor spaces, and much more.

**This is a promotional winter price (up to May). For the summer months rent price will be $7500/monthly (after May). Excepting flexible short-term leases. A longer-term lease can be an option. Longer-term leases would be $6500 up to May and then $7500 for the following months**

Home Features:
- Living room has open views of Quinnipiac River and has a woodstove
- Open kitchen with dishwasher
- Mater bedroom faces Quinnipiac River. Has a private deck, private bathroom, and walk-in closet
- 2nd bedroom fits a queen size bed
- Outdoor space is fully furnished, with a grill, outdoor furniture, a hot tub, 2 bikes, and 2 kayaks on your private dock
- 2.5 modern bathrooms
- Laundry in-unit
